Puget Sound Salish vs Lebanese Female Unemployment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 46,055,319 people shows a significant positive correlation between the proportion of Puget Sound Salish and unemploymnet rate among females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.641 and weighted average of 5.1%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 399,531,813 people shows a strong positive correlation between the proportion of Lebanese and unemploymnet rate among females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.702 and weighted average of 5.1%, a difference of 0.44%.
